Quick and Easy Basil Beef Rolls Recipe

These Quick and Easy Basil Beef Rolls combine savory ground beef with aromatic herbs, fresh vegetables, and a tangy dipping sauce wrapped in soft tortillas or rice paper. Ready in just 20 minutes, they are perfect for a flavorful appetizer or light meal.

Ingredients

For the Beef Filling

  • 1 lb ground beef (or ground chicken/turkey)
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tbsp fresh ginger, grated
  • 1 tsp Chinese 5-spice powder
  • 2 tbsp low-sodium soy sauce or tamari
  • 1 tbsp Thai chili sauce
  • 1 tsp toasted sesame oil

For the Rolls

  • 8 small flour tortillas or rice paper
  • 2 Persian cucumbers, julienned
  • 1 cup fresh cilantro
  • 1 cup Thai basil (or Italian basil)
  • 3 green onions, chopped
  • ½ cup roasted peanuts, chopped

For the Dipping Sauce (Optional)

  • 1 tbsp honey
  • 1 tbsp ketchup
  • 1 tbsp chili paste
  • 1 tsp lime zest
  • 1 tbsp lime juice
  • 1 tbsp rice vinegar
  • 1 tbsp tamari
  • 1 tsp grated ginger
  • 1 clove garlic, grated

Instructions

  1. Prepare the sauce mix: In a small bowl, combine soy sauce, Thai chili sauce, toasted sesame oil, and Chinese 5-spice powder. This mixture will flavor the beef filling.
  2. Cook the beef: Heat a skillet over medium-high heat and brown the ground beef until no longer pink. Add the minced garlic and grated ginger, cooking for 2 minutes until aromatic.
  3. Add sauce to beef: Stir in the prepared sauce mixture and continue cooking until the beef is glazed and slightly caramelized, about 3-5 minutes. Remove from heat.
  4. Prepare wrappers: Warm the flour tortillas in a dry pan or microwave until pliable, or soften rice paper according to package instructions for easy rolling.
  5. Assemble the rolls: On each tortilla or rice paper, layer a portion of the beef mixture, fresh herbs (cilantro and basil), julienned cucumber, chopped green onions, and chopped roasted peanuts. Wrap tightly to form rolls.
  6. Make the dipping sauce (optional): In a small bowl, whisk together honey, ketchup, chili paste, lime zest, lime juice, rice vinegar, tamari, grated ginger, and grated garlic until well combined.
  7. Serve: Serve the beef rolls warm with the optional dipping sauce on the side for added flavor.

Notes

  • You can substitute ground beef with ground chicken or turkey for a leaner option.
  • Rice paper offers a gluten-free alternative to flour tortillas.
  • Adjust the chili sauce and chili paste amount according to your preferred spice level.
  • For a vegetarian version, replace beef with seasoned tofu or mushrooms.
  • Prepare the dipping sauce ahead to let flavors meld.
